Firstsource Solutions Limited, a member of the RP-Sanjiv Goenka Group, announced its audited financial results for the quarter and nine months ended December 31, 2025. The Board of Directors approved a significant interim dividend of ₹5.50 per share (55%) for the financial year ending March 31, 2026, with the record date set for February 20, 2026. During the quarter, the company’s consolidated revenue from operations reached ₹24,674.47 million, marking a 6.60% growth compared to the previous quarter (QoQ) and an 18.18% increase over the corresponding quarter of the previous year (YoY). However, the consolidated net profit after tax for the quarter was ₹1,203.29 million, reflecting a 32.97% decline from the previous quarter and a 24.94% decrease from the same period last year. This profit reduction was largely influenced by exceptional items totaling ₹1,001.45 million, primarily driven by a one-time expense related to the new Labour Codes in India.
| Financial Result Analysis (Consolidated) | Current Quarter (Dec 2025) | % Change (QoQ) | % Change (YoY) |
| Revenue from Operations | ₹24,674.47 Million | 6.60% Increase | 18.18% Increase |
| Net Profit After Tax | ₹1,203.29 Million | 32.97% Decrease | 24.94% Decrease |
Firstsource Solutions Limited is a leading provider of business process management (BPM) services, operating across sectors such as Banking and Financial Services, Healthcare, and Communications. In 2025, the company continued its strategic expansion by acquiring 100% ownership of Pastdue Credit Solutions Limited (PDC) in the UK for approximately GBP 22 million, a move completed in December 2025 to bolster its debt collection and recovery services. The company also established new entities, including Firstsource Middle East Services L.L.C in July 2025 and Firstsource Solutions Canada Inc. in October 2025, to broaden its global footprint. On the leadership front, the company sought shareholder approval via postal ballot for the continuation of Dr. Rajiv Kumar as a Non-Executive Independent Director beyond the age of 75. Firstsource remains a key entity within the RP-Sanjiv Goenka Group, focusing on delivering transformation and tangible results for its global clientele.
